DBA Data[Home] [Help]

PACKAGE BODY: APPS.IGW_GR_MIGRATION

Source


1 PACKAGE BODY IGW_GR_MIGRATION AS
2 --$Header: igwgrmigrationb.pls 120.3 2005/09/30 00:54:54 ashkumar ship $
3 
4    ---------------------------------------------------------------------------
5 
6    g_package_name CONSTANT  VARCHAR2(30) := 'IGW_GR_MIGRATION';
7    g_igw_literal          CONSTANT  VARCHAR2(30) := 'IGW';
8    g_stage                  VARCHAR2(500);
9    g_user_id                NUMBER(15);
10    g_login_id               NUMBER(15);
11    g_currency_code          VARCHAR2(30);
12    g_fiscal_year_start_mmdd VARCHAR2(30);
13    g_budget_template_id     NUMBER;
14 
15    ---------------------------------------------------------------------------
16 
17    PROCEDURE Proposal_Migration
18    (
19       errbuf  OUT NOCOPY VARCHAR2,
20       retcode OUT NOCOPY NUMBER
21    ) IS
22    BEGIN
23 	NULL;
24 
25 END Proposal_Migration;
26 
27    ---------------------------------------------------------------------------
28 
29    PROCEDURE Security_Migration
30    (
31       x_msg_data      OUT NOCOPY VARCHAR2,
32       x_return_status OUT NOCOPY VARCHAR2
33    ) IS
34 
35    BEGIN
36 	NULL;
37 
38 END Security_Migration;
39 
40    ---------------------------------------------------------------------------
41 
42    PROCEDURE Budget_Migration
43    (
44       p_init_msg_list IN VARCHAR2,
45       p_validate_only IN VARCHAR2,
46       p_commit        IN VARCHAR2,
47       p_proposal_id   IN NUMBER,
48       p_version_id    IN NUMBER,
49       x_return_status OUT NOCOPY VARCHAR2,
50       x_msg_count     OUT NOCOPY NUMBER,
51       x_msg_data      OUT NOCOPY VARCHAR2
52    ) IS
53 
54    BEGIN
55 	NULL;
56 
57 END Budget_Migration;
58 
59    ---------------------------------------------------------------------------
60 
61    FUNCTION Get_Latest_Version_Id(p_proposal_id NUMBER) RETURN NUMBER IS
62 
63       l_api_name CONSTANT VARCHAR2(30) := 'Get_Latest_Version_Id';
64 
65       l_version_id NUMBER;
66 
67    BEGIN
68 
69       RETURN null;
70 
71    END Get_Latest_Version_Id;
72 
73    ---------------------------------------------------------------------------
74 
75    PROCEDURE Log(p_log_msg IN VARCHAR2) IS
76    BEGIN
77 
78       NULL;
79 
80    END Log;
81 
82    ---------------------------------------------------------------------------
83 
84    PROCEDURE Set_Stage(p_stage IN VARCHAR2) IS
85    BEGIN
86 
87       g_stage := p_stage;
88       Log('');
89       Log('Migration Stage : '||g_stage||'...');
90 
91    END Set_Stage;
92 
93    ---------------------------------------------------------------------------
94 
95    PROCEDURE Display_Rowcount IS
96    BEGIN
97 
98       Log(SQL%ROWCOUNT||' rows migrated in '||g_stage);
99 
100    END Display_Rowcount;
101 
102    ---------------------------------------------------------------------------
103 
104    PROCEDURE Execute_Commit IS
105    BEGIN
106 
107       Log('**** Committing data...');
108       COMMIT;
109       Log('DATA COMMITTED');
110 
111    END Execute_Commit;
112 
113    ---------------------------------------------------------------------------
114 
115    FUNCTION Get_Location_Code(p_budget_vers_exp_category_id NUMBER) RETURN VARCHAR2 IS
116 
117    BEGIN
118 
119       RETURN null;
120 
121    END Get_Location_Code;
122 
123   ---------------------------------------------------------------------------
124 
125    FUNCTION Get_Oh_Eb_Flag
126    (
127       p_budget_vers_exp_category_id NUMBER,
128       p_rate_class_type VARCHAR2
129    )
130    RETURN VARCHAR2 IS
131 
132    BEGIN
133 
134 
135       RETURN null;
136 
137    END Get_Oh_Eb_Flag;
138 
139    ---------------------------------------------------------------------------
140 
141 END Igw_Gr_Migration;